Royal wedding chatter sets social media abuzz

With the April 29 wedding of William and Kate now looming large, the internet is increasingly awash with natter about the upcoming event.

Data from Bing suggests that news stories penned in reference to the event have increased to a hefty seven million per day, up from just one million per day at the beginning of the month.

Royal wedding related blog posts meanwhile have jumped from 46.7m at the start of the month to hit 102.9m.

YouTube hasn’t been spared the Royal fever either with the volume of videos posted with wedding associated tags leaping from 37.5k per day to 460k per day.

Twitter meanwhile has witnessed an explosion in tweets discussing the upcoming exchange of vows, with around 5,000 per hour being posted, a figure which has expanded rapidly in recent weeks.

Trendrr aver that these posts are largely positive with 46% of tweets speaking favourably of the couple with just 12% negative, the remainder being neutral.
